Moreno Baldivieso transformed the traditional paradigms that shaped the practice of law in Bolivia, being recognized as the leader of the country’s legal market. The firm operates under a highly sophisticated full-service approach, designed to meet the complex needs of multinational corporations, international financial institutions, embassies, and leading local companies involved in large-scale investment development.
It is one of the largest firms in the country, with a strategic and widespread presence through its own offices in Bolivia’s central corporate and political hubs: Santa Cruz de la Sierra (financial center), La Paz (government seat), Cochabamba, and Sucre.
The team is composed of more than 50 highly specialized legal professionals, multilingual and with postgraduate education from the most prestigious universities in Europe and the United States.
It is considered one of the largest law firms in Bolivia with international recognition, achieving the distinction of “Bolivian Firm of the Year” nine times in the past 12 years by the Chambers and Partners directory.
Its specialized knowledge has provided the opportunity to participate in the most important business operations carried out in the Bolivian market. It has also represented multinational companies, international organizations, and local businesses in the development of their projects.
Moreno Baldivieso maintains preferential and exclusive alliances with the most important legal networks in the world. On one hand, it is the exclusive member for Bolivia of the World Services Group (WSG), a prestigious global network that brings together leading professional services firms in over 150 countries. On the other hand, it is part of the select Ibero-American Lawyers’ Club, facilitating the immediate coordination of cross-border transactions and investments throughout Latin America and Europe.
